WHEREAS, the Urban Areas Security Initiative (UASI) Grant Program’s mission is to enhance regional preparedness in major metropolitan areas through direct assistance to participating jurisdictions in developing an integrated regional system for prevention, protection, response and recovery from terrorist events or natural catastrophes; and

WHEREAS, on behalf of the City of Newark, the Director of the Office of Emergency Management and Homeland Security submitted investment justifications to the State of New Jersey Office of Homeland Security and Preparedness which submits the full application to the U.S. Department of Homeland Security on behalf of the UASI region requesting an Urban Areas Security Initiative Grant in the amount of $1,608.858.66 from the U.S. Department of Homeland Security for maintenance of equipment, smart boards and radios; and
